How general functioning of family affects gambling-related beliefs: the mediating role of communication and the moderating role of impulsivity trait.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

Gambling behaviors can be exhibited by individuals raised in families with impaired parent-child communication and individuals with more impulsive traits. However, it remains unclear how gambling-related beliefs are modulated by impulsivity traits and parent-child communication styles.

METHODS

A total of 95 adult patients (age ≥ 18 years) diagnosed via DSM-5 criteria with gambling disorder (GD) completed our questionnaire. Participants filled out pen-and-paper questionnaires that included basic demographic information, the Family Assessment Device (FAD), Parent-Adolescent Communication Scale (PACS), Gambling Attitude and Belief Survey (GABS), and Barratt Impulsiveness Scale (BIS). We used a moderation mediation model to explore the relationship between variables. The study results were considered statistically significant if < 0.05, or the 95% confidence interval did not contain zero.

RESULTS

The scores of the problems in communication with mother subscale (PCMS) of PACS were significantly positively correlated with the scores of GABS and the general functioning 12-item subscale (GF12) of FAD. The relationship between the scores of GF12 and GABS was completely mediated [β = 4.83, (1.12, 10.02)] by PCMS scores, and the BIS scores moderated this relationship: the predictive path between GF12 and PCMS scores [index of moderated was β = -0.25, (-0.60, -0.04)], and the indirect predictive front path between the scores of GF12 and GABS were significant only in subjects with low BIS scores.

CONCLUSION

These findings suggest that poor general functioning of the family may increase gambling-related beliefs as a result of communication problems with mothers, and this result is only significant for individuals with low impulsivity. When treating patients with GD, more treatment of mother-child communication issues and individual impulsivity may be more conducive to their recovery.

摘要

背景

在亲子沟通受损的家庭中成长的个体以及具有更冲动特质的个体可能会表现出赌博行为。然而,尚不清楚与赌博相关的信念是如何受到冲动特质和亲子沟通方式的调节的。

方法

共有95名通过DSM-5标准诊断为赌博障碍(GD)的成年患者(年龄≥18岁)完成了我们的问卷调查。参与者填写了纸质问卷,包括基本人口统计学信息、家庭评估量表(FAD)、亲子沟通量表(PACS)、赌博态度和信念调查(GABS)以及巴拉特冲动性量表(BIS)。我们使用调节中介模型来探讨变量之间的关系。如果P<0.05或95%置信区间不包含零,则研究结果被认为具有统计学意义。

结果

PACS中与母亲沟通问题子量表(PCMS)的得分与GABS的得分以及FAD的一般功能12项子量表(GF12)的得分显著正相关。GF12得分与GABS得分之间的关系完全由PCMS得分介导[β = 4.83,(1.12,10.02)],并且BIS得分调节了这种关系:GF12与PCMS得分之间的预测路径[调节指数为β = -0.25,(-0.60,-0.04)],并且GF12得分与GABS得分之间的间接预测前路径仅在低BIS得分的受试者中显著。

结论

这些发现表明,家庭整体功能不佳可能由于与母亲的沟通问题而增加与赌博相关的信念,并且这一结果仅在低冲动性个体中显著。在治疗GD患者时,更多地处理亲子沟通问题和个体冲动性可能更有利于他们的康复。
